Abstract:BackgroundThe application of deep learning methods in rapid bone scintigraphy is increasingly promising for minimizing the duration of SPECT examinations. Recent works showed several deep learning models based on simulated data for the synthesis of high‐count bone scintigraphy images from low‐count counterparts.
